Android Reverse Engineering & API Extraction — Claude Code skill
A Claude Code skill that decompiles Android APK/XAPK/JAR/AAR files and extracts the HTTP APIs used by the app — Retrofit endpoints, OkHttp calls, hardcoded URLs, authentication patterns — so you can document and reproduce them without the original source code.
What it does
- Decompiles APK, XAPK, JAR, and AAR files using jadx and Fernflower/Vineflower (single engine or side-by-side comparison)
- Extracts and documents APIs: Retrofit endpoints, OkHttp calls, hardcoded URLs, auth headers and tokens
- Traces call flows from Activities/Fragments through ViewModels and repositories down to HTTP calls
- Analyzes app structure: manifest, packages, architecture patterns
- Handles obfuscated code: strategies for navigating ProGuard/R8 output
Requirements
Required:
- Java JDK 17+
- jadx (CLI)
Optional (recommended):
- Vineflower or Fernflower — better output on complex Java code
- dex2jar — needed to use Fernflower on APK/DEX files

Usage
Slash command
/decompile path/to/app.apk
This runs the full workflow: dependency check, decompilation, and initial structure analysis.
Natural language
The skill activates on phrases like:
- "Decompile this APK"
- "Reverse engineer this Android app"
- "Extract API endpoints from this app"
- "Follow the call flow from LoginActivity"
- "Analyze this AAR library"
Manual scripts
The scripts can also be used standalone:
# Check dependencies
bash plugins/android-reverse-engineering/skills/android-reverse-engineering/scripts/check-deps.sh
# Install a missing dependency (auto-detects OS and package manager)
bash plugins/android-reverse-engineering/skills/android-reverse-engineering/scripts/install-dep.sh jadx
bash plugins/android-reverse-engineering/skills/android-reverse-engineering/scripts/install-dep.sh vineflower
# Decompile APK with jadx (default)
bash plugins/android-reverse-engineering/skills/android-reverse-engineering/scripts/decompile.sh app.apk
# Decompile XAPK (auto-extracts and decompiles each APK inside)
bash plugins/android-reverse-engineering/skills/android-reverse-engineering/scripts/decompile.sh app-bundle.xapk
# Decompile with Fernflower
bash plugins/android-reverse-engineering/skills/android-reverse-engineering/scripts/decompile.sh --engine fernflower library.jar
# Run both engines and compare
bash plugins/android-reverse-engineering/skills/android-reverse-engineering/scripts/decompile.sh --engine both --deobf app.apk
# Find API calls
bash plugins/android-reverse-engineering/skills/android-reverse-engineering/scripts/find-api-calls.sh output/sources/
bash plugins/android-reverse-engineering/skills/android-reverse-engineering/scripts/find-api-calls.sh output/sources/ --retrofit
bash plugins/android-reverse-engineering/skills/android-reverse-engineering/scripts/find-api-calls.sh output/sources/ --urls
